Kuinka Linux-säilöt toimivat Windowsissa?

Voivatko Linux-säilöt toimia Windowsissa?

On nyt on mahdollista ajaa Docker-säilöjä Windows 10:ssä ja Windows Serverissä, hyödyntäen Ubuntua isännöintipohjana. Kuvittele, että käytät omia Linux-sovelluksiasi Windowsissa käyttämällä Linux-jakelua, johon olet tyytyväinen: Ubuntu!

Kuinka voin ottaa Linux-säilöt käyttöön Windowsissa?

Edellytykset

  1. Asenna Windows 10, versio 2004 tai uudempi (Build 19041 tai uudempi).
  2. Ota WSL 2 -ominaisuus käyttöön Windowsissa.
  3. Ota käyttöön valinnainen "Virtual Machine Platform" -komponentti.
  4. Asenna linux-ydinpaketti, joka tarvitaan WSL-version päivittämiseen WSL 2:ksi.
  5. Aseta WSL 2 oletusversioksi.

Voitko rakentaa Linux Docker -säiliön Windowsiin?

Docker-alusta toimii natiivina Linuxissa (x86-64, ARM ja monissa muissa suoritinarkkitehtuureissa) ja Windowsissa (x86-64). Satamatyöläinen Inc. rakentaa tuotteita, joiden avulla voit rakentaa ja käyttää säiliöitä Linuxissa, Windowsissa ja macOS:ssä.

Onko Docker parempi Windows vai Linux?

Tekniseltä kannalta katsottuna Dockerin käytön välillä ei ole todellista eroa Windowsissa ja Linuxissa. Voit saavuttaa samat asiat Dockerilla molemmilla alustoilla. En usko, että voit sanoa, että joko Windows tai Linux on "parempi" Dockerin isännöintiin.

Voiko Docker-säilö toimia sekä Windowsissa että Linuxissa?

Kun Docker for Windows on käynnistetty ja Windows-säilöt on valittu, voit nyt käyttää joko Windows- tai Linux-säilöjä samanaikaisesti. Uutta –platform=linux-komentorivikytkintä käytetään Linux-kuvien noutamiseen tai käynnistämiseen Windowsissa. Käynnistä nyt Linux-säilö ja Windows Server Core -säilö.

Mikä on Kubernetes vs Docker?

Olennainen ero Kubernetesin ja Dockerin välillä on se Kubernetes on tarkoitettu ajamaan klusterin poikki, kun taas Docker toimii yhdessä solmussa. Kubernetes on laajempi kuin Docker Swarm, ja sen tarkoituksena on koordinoida solmuklustereita tuotannon mittakaavassa tehokkaasti.

Voinko käyttää Windows Docker -kuvaa Linuxissa?

Ei, et voi käyttää Windows-säilöjä suoraan Linuxissa. Mutta voit käyttää Linuxia Windowsissa. Voit vaihtaa käyttöjärjestelmäsäilöjen Linuxin ja Windowsin välillä napsauttamalla hiiren kakkospainikkeella Dockeria tarjotinvalikossa. Säilöissä käytetään käyttöjärjestelmän ydintä.

Voitko käyttää Docker-säilöjä natiivisti Windowsissa?

Docker-säiliöt voi toimia vain alkuperäisesti Windows Server 2016:ssa ja Windows 10:ssä. … Toisin sanoen et voi ajaa Linuxille käännettyä sovellusta Windowsissa toimivassa Docker-säiliössä. Tarvitset Windows-isännän tehdäksesi sen.

Kuinka vaihdan Windows Docker -säilöihin?

Vaihda Windows- ja Linux-säilöjen välillä

Docker Desktop -valikosta voit vaihtaa, minkä demonin (Linux tai Windows) kanssa Dockerin CLI puhuu. Valitse Vaihda Windows-säilöihin, jos haluat käyttää Windows-säilöjä, tai valitse Vaihda Linux-säilöihin, jos haluat käyttää Linux-säilöjä (oletus).

Kuinka otan Windows Container -ominaisuuden käyttöön?

Tämä toimittaja ottaa käyttöön säilötoiminnon Windowsissa ja asentaa Docker-moottorin ja asiakkaan. Näin: Avaa korotettu PowerShell istunto ja asenna Docker-Microsoft PackageManagement Provider PowerShell-galleriasta. Jos sinua kehotetaan asentamaan NuGet-toimittaja, kirjoita Y asentaaksesi myös sen.

Mitä voin tehdä Docker for Windowsilla?

Docker Desktop on helposti asennettava sovellus Mac- tai Windows-ympäristöön avulla voit rakentaa ja jakaa säilöttyjä sovelluksia ja mikropalveluita. Docker Desktop sisältää Docker Enginen, Docker CLI -asiakkaan, Docker Composen, Docker Content Trustin, Kubernetesin ja Credential Helperin.

Sisältääkö Docker-kuvat käyttöjärjestelmän?

Jokainen kuva sisältää täydellisen käyttöjärjestelmän. Erikoistelakka teki käyttöjärjestelmän mukana muutaman megatavun: esimerkiksi linux Alpine, joka on 8 megatavun käyttöjärjestelmä! Mutta isommat käyttöjärjestelmät, kuten ubuntu/windows, voivat olla muutaman gigatavun kokoisia.

Onko Docker ainoa kontti?

Näin ei kuitenkaan ole enää, eikä Docker ole ainoa, vaan pikemminkin vain yksi konttimoottori maisemassa. Dockerin avulla voimme rakentaa, ajaa, vetää, työntää tai tarkastaa konttikuvia, mutta jokaiselle näistä tehtävistä on olemassa muita vaihtoehtoisia työkaluja, jotka saattavat toimia paremmin kuin Docker.

Käytetäänkö Dockeria käyttöönottoon?

Yksinkertaisesti sanottuna Docker on työkalu, jonka avulla kehittäjät voivat luoda, ottaa käyttöön ja suorittaa sovelluksia säilöissä. … Voit ottaa päivityksiä ja päivityksiä käyttöön lennossa. Kannettava. Voit rakentaa paikallisesti, ottaa käyttöön pilvessä ja käyttää missä tahansa.

Tykkää tämä viesti? Ole hyvä ja jaa ystävillesi:
OS tänään